Literature summary extracted from

  • Kovalchuk, S.N.; Bakunina, I.Y.; Burtseva, Y.V.; Emelyanenko, V.I.; Kim, N.Y.; Guzev, K.V.; Kozhemyako, V.B.; Rasskazov, V.A.; Zvyagintseva, T.N.
    An endo-(1-->3)-beta-D-glucanase from the scallop Chlamys albidus: catalytic properties, cDNA cloning and secondary-structure characterization (2009), Carbohydr. Res., 344, 191-197.
